What is Pcwizosd.dll?

A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is like a set of instructions that can be shared by different programs on a Windows computer. Imagine it as a toolbox that contains tools that different software can use. For instance, pcwizosd.dll is a DLL file that's related to the software PC Wizard.

This file contains specific functions and resources that the PC Wizard program needs to run smoothly. When PC Wizard is running, it uses pcwizosd.dll to access certain features and capabilities. pcwizosd.dll is important because it provides essential functions and resources to PC Wizard, which would not work properly without it.

Basically, without pcwizosd.dll, PC Wizard wouldn't be able to perform some of its key tasks. So, it's like a behind-the-scenes helper that makes sure PC Wizard can do its job properly.

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:

  • Pcwizosd.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message indicates that the DLL file is either not compatible with your Windows version or has an internal problem. It could be due to a programming error in the DLL, or an attempt to use a DLL from a different version of Windows.
  • Pcwizosd.dll Access Violation: The error signifies that an operation attempted to access a protected portion of memory associated with the pcwizosd.dll. This could happen due to improper coding, software incompatibilities, or memory-related issues.
  • Cannot register pcwizosd.dll: This error is indicative of the system's inability to correctly register the DLL file. This might occur due to issues with the Windows Registry or because the DLL file itself is corrupt or improperly installed.
  • Pcwizosd.dll could not be loaded: This means that the DLL file required by a specific program or process could not be loaded into memory. This could be due to corruption of the DLL file, improper installation, or compatibility issues with your operating system.
  • The file pcwizosd.dll is missing: The specified DLL file couldn't be found. It may have been unintentionally deleted or moved from its original location.

Perform a Clean Boot

Perform a Clean Boot Thumbnail
Difficulty
Intermediate
Steps
13
Time Required
10 minutes
Sections
7
Description

How to perform a clean boot. This can isolate the issue with pcwizosd.dll and help resolve the problem.

Step 1: Press Windows + R keys

Step 1: Press Windows + R keys Thumbnail
  1. This opens the Run dialog box.

Step 2: Open System Configuration

Step 2: Open System Configuration Thumbnail
  1. Type msconfig and press Enter.

Step 3: Select Selective Startup

Step 3: Select Selective Startup Thumbnail
  1. In the General tab, select Selective startup.

  2. Uncheck Load startup items.

Step 4: Disable All Microsoft Services

Step 4: Disable All Microsoft Services Thumbnail
  1. Go to the Services tab.

  2. Check Hide all Microsoft services.

  3. Click Disable all.

Step 5: Disable Startup Programs

Step 5: Disable Startup Programs Thumbnail
  1. Open Task Manager.

  2. Go to the Startup tab.

  3. Disable all the startup programs.

Step 6: Restart Your Computer

Step 6: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. Click OK on the System Configuration window.

  2. Restart your computer.

Step 7: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 7: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the computer restarts, check if the pcwizosd.dll problem persists.
